In the first  months after the legalization of cannabis, sales at cannabis stores in Saskatchewan were lagging behind every other province in the country, according to the latest figures from Statistics Canada.

Across Canada, $151.5 million in cannabis was sold from the date of legalization on Oct.17, 2018, to the end of December. 

Cannabis sales from October to December, across Canada:

  • Quebec - $33 million
  • Alberta - $33 million
  • Ontario - $29 million
  • Nova Scotia - $17.2 million
  • New Brunswick - $8.5 million
  • Newfoundland and Labrador - $7.2 million
  • British Columbia - $4.6 million
  • Manitoba - $4.3 million (only includes data from December) 
  • Prince Edward Island - $3.4 million 
  • Saskatchewan - $2.5 million 
  • Yukon - $403,000 (only includes data from December)
  • Northwest Territories - $205,000 (only includes data from December)
